If we hit that point, it’s then a question of access, cost, learning curve, and vision of individual companies. Some things are technically possible, but done by very few companies.
I’ve seen the videos of Amazon warehouses, where the shelves move around to make popular items more accessible for those fetching stuff. This is possible today, but what percentage of companies do this? At what point is it with the investment for a growing company? For some companies it’s never worth it. Others don’t have the vision to see the light at the end of the tunnel.
A lot of things that we may think of as old or standard practice at this point would be game changing for some smaller companies outside of tech. I hear my friends and family talking about various things they have to do at their job. A day writing a few scripts could solve a significant amount of toil. But they can’t even conceptualize where to begin to change that, they aren’t even thinking about it. Release all the AI the world has to offer and they still won’t. I bet some freelance devs could make a good living bouncing from company to company pair programming with their AI to solve some pretty basic problems for small non-tech companies that would be game changes for them, while being rather trivial to do. Maybe partner with a sales guy to find the companies and sell them on the benefits.
